If you were charged with a criminal offense or traffic violation in Helmetta it is of no consequence that the municipality has the lowest volume in Middlesex County. Your charge is no different from one issued anywhere else and exposes you to serious consequences if you fail to properly defend the charge. A conviction for a disorderly persons offense, for example, harassmentsimple assaultdrug paraphernalia or possession of 50 grams or less of marijuana, even carries up to six months in jail. Helmetta Municipal Court Information

The Helmetta Municipal Court is located at 60 Main Street, Helmetta, N.J. 08828. The telephone number for the court and its administrator, Danielle Tanzi, is 732-521-4946. Court proceedings are conducted once a month on the second Tuesday of the month at 5:00 p.m. The judge that sits in Helmetta is Honorable Edward H. Herman. The municipal court has jurisdiction to decide three types of violations arising within the boundaries of its .90 square feet. The court may decide misdemeanor criminal charges, traffic summonses, and municipal ordinance offenses. There is no authority to deal with indictable crimes of the first degree, second degree, third degree or fourth degree like burglarycriminal sexual contact, possession of cocaine or distribution of marijuana. The Middlesex County Superior Court has responsibility to adjudicate matters falling within these grades of offense.

Directions to Helmetta Municipal Court

From Interstate 95/NJ Turnpike. Take Exit 8A and merge onto Forsgate Drive. Turn left onto Half Acre Road and then quickly left onto Gatzmer Avenue. Make a right on Lincoln Avenue. Turn left on Helmetta Road in .4 miles. The roadway will merge into Main Street where the municipal court is located.

From New Jersey Route 18. Exit on Old Bridge Turnpike and turn right in .1 miles on Main Street. The roadway will transition into Manalapan Road and in 1.5 miles back into Main Street. The court will be to your left in .2 miles.

From New Jersey Route 33. Exit roadway at Perrineville Road. You will need to bear left onto Gatzmer in approximately 6 miles. Turn right onto Lincoln Avenue in one-half mile and left on Helmetta Road in .4 miles. Proceed for .8 miles to Main Street. Helmetta Municipal Court will be to your right.
